Big Brother fans were in for a nostalgic surprise this week as Helen Adams, the beloved housemate from the second season of the iconic reality show, was spotted in her hometown of Bristol. The 45-year-old, who captured hearts with her endearing and ditzy personality, has come a long way since her time on the show in 2001.
Helen, who once famously declared, ‘I like blinking, I do,’ quickly became a fan favorite during her stint on Big Brother. She made headlines for her love story with fellow contestant Paul Clarke. The duo’s romance blossomed under the watchful eyes of millions, and they became one of the show’s original power couples.

After finishing as the runner-up in the competition, Helen transitioned into the world of television, making appearances on popular shows like Loose Women, GMTV, and Ready, Steady Cook. However, fame came with its own set of challenges, and the pressures eventually took a toll on her relationship with Paul.
In a candid interview with Heat Magazine in 2006, Paul revealed, ‘It starts to drain you. It’s not that I don’t like talking about Helen, I just wanted to get away from it and be a private person again.’ Helen added, ‘I felt like the Wicked Witch because I was the first to say something.’ Their relationship eventually came to an end, allowing both Helen and Paul to pursue separate paths away from the limelight.

Helen has since settled down in Bristol, where she works as a hairdresser, embracing a quieter life away from the cameras. She is now a proud mother, enjoying the simple pleasures of family and work in her hometown.
Meanwhile, Paul Clarke, now in his mid-40s, made a successful exit from the public eye, carving a niche for himself in the world of car design. He left his corporate job to establish his own consulting firm in 2019. Describing himself as a ‘passionate forward-thinking individual,’ Paul is dedicated to challenging and developing people to be their best selves.
